## Data Stores — Payvern Integration Tests

The flaky failures in the Payvern settlement suite trace back to test isolation, not the ledger code itself. Each test run shares the staging transactions database, and parallel workers occasionally collide on the same idempotency rows, producing intermittent constraint violations. Until we move to per-worker schemas, please serialize the settlement tests with the `--single-lane` flag. For reproducing locally, you will need read access to the shared staging store. Connect with the following string:

warehouse DSN: postgresql://kasax_svc:qKMoO2AkuKwZ23@db-b256.kelviio.example:5432/framir

## Export Memory Basics

Gridbarn plugins that stream spreadsheet exports should keep working sets under 64 MB; the host process caps each export worker and kills anything over budget. Use the row-chunk iterator rather than loading full sheets. To profile your plugin against the internal telemetry service, authenticate with the sandbox key below.

service key, bajep-hahig: zpat15_8GdlyV2kd9BCqYH

External plugins hook into Duskhawk's dedup pipeline after fingerprinting but before suppression. Your plugin runs in an isolated worker, so declare every env var you need in the manifest; undeclared reads return empty strings. Start from the sample env file: set `DEDUP_WINDOW_SECONDS`, `PLUGIN_LOG_LEVEL`, and your plugin slug, then register with the sandbox gateway. The gateway rejects unauthenticated plugins, so after the slug line you must provide your plugin's gateway secret on the very next line.

vault entry, yahif-yajep: COURIER_KEY29=b802bdf8034096b65a51c6ba5abe2

Subject: Bloomgate cut-over done

Hey all,

We finished moving the Bloomgate filter in front of the Pebblevault KV store last night. False-positive rate is sitting right where we predicted, and read traffic to the backing store dropped by roughly a third. The old passthrough path is still there behind a flag if anything looks weird, but plan to rip it out next sprint. For whoever inherits this, here's the config the filter is running with.

service settings:
[briius]
port = 3000
region = outer-1
host = briius.zarqeldyn.internal
team = wenael
timeout_ms = 2000
retries = 5